金黄色葡萄球菌的演相培养及A蛋白的提取

摘    要:对金黄色葡萄球菌(Staphylococcusaureus)CowanⅠ的培养及A蛋白提取工艺进行了优化研究.结果表明:在培养基中分别增加牛肉膏和蛋白陈的含量,有利于提高菌体生物量及A蛋白的得率;少量酵母浸膏及葡萄糖对生物量及A蛋白得率有促进作用,但当达到一定浓度时则会产生基质抑制作用;恒定培养过程的pH值有利于A蛋白得率的增加,0.03()/min通气量、搅拌速度200r/min是能满足菌体生长的条件.根据A蛋白耐热性强这一特性,采用加热法除去大部分杂质,然后用IgG-琼脂糖凝胶亲和层析实现了A蛋白的提纯.

FERMENTATION OF STAPHYLOCOCCUS AUREUS AND EXTRACTION OF PROTEIN A

Abstract:The fermentation of Staphylococcus aureus Cowan I and extraction of SpA were studied.The results indicated that it would ho beneficial for biomass and SpA prodwtion to increase the amount of beef extract or peptone in medium.The addition of small amount of yeast extract or glucose could promote biomass and SpA production,but over addition could produce an inhibition in the production.The studies on pH,aeration rate and agitation speed showed that constant PH was good for SpA production,0.3()/min and 200 r/min could provide enough oxygen for the growth of bacteria in a 6 liter fermentor.Heating extraction method was used to remove the majority of impurity. Protein A was purified with IgG-sepharose affinity chromatography.
